The All Compassionate (Al-Rahman)
78 verses, revealed in Medina after Thunder (Al-Ra'ad) before The Human (Al-Insan)
In the name of Allah, the Beneficent, the Merciful
۞ The Most Merciful 1 has taught the Qur'an, 2 has created man, 3 Has taught him the knowledge of the past and the future. 4 The sun and the moon follow a reckoning. 5 And the herbs and the trees do obeisance. 6 And the sky He hath uplifted; and He hath set the measure, 7 that you may not transgress in the balance, 8 but weigh things equitably and skimp not in the balance. 9 And the earth He has put for the creatures. 10 There are fruits of all kinds on it, and date-palms with their clusters sheathed, 11 and grain growing tall on its stalks, and sweet-smelling plants. 12 Then which of the favours of your Lord will ye deny? 13 He created man of clay like, unto pottery. 14 And He created the jinn of a flame of fire. 15 Then which of the Blessings of your Lord will you both (jinns and men) deny? 16 Lord of the East and Lord of the West. 17 So which of the favors of your Lord would you deny? 18 He has set two seas in motion that flow side by side together, 19 Whereas there is a barrier between them so they cannot encroach upon one another. 20 O which of your Lord's bounties will you and you deny? 21 Out of them both come out pearl and coral. 22 Which favors of your Lord will you both belie? 23 His are the high-sailed vessels in deep ocean like the mountains. 24 Which is it, of the favours of your Lord, that ye deny? 25
